This woman that i met while on Bonthe Island cannot speak, she is mute, and her face is striking. She is a mother of three equally stunning children. There fathers are sperm donors, they are not with her. It is quite an experience spending time with her. Her eyes dance, she is aware, and her entire body communicates. This is not a sad story, this woman seems comfortable in her skin, she readily posed for other photos. This image was captured because i was enthralled by her being. Love Rain on us all.
